Abstract (EN)

Qashqai Turkish is a dialect of Oğuz Turkish and geographically represents the southest branch of Oguz Language.Qashqai Turks live as nomads around Persian Region of Iran. Because of living conditions and political reasons most of Qasqai Turks have a settled life, today. Ones who have settled life remove from their traditions, customs and languages. This rapid change will result in vanishing of an important Turkish cultural asset, in a short time. Thus, gathering and publishing and introducing to Turkish World of texts in Qashqai Turkish as soon as possible, has a great importance.?Darbu?l-meselha-yı Türkî-i Kaşkai? Atalar Sözü of Esadullah Merdani Rahimi, constitutes the base of this study. This work has been written in Qashqai Turkish and explanations of proverbs have also taken place in Persian Language.First of all, we made transcription of materials in Qashqai Language which were written with Arabic Letters, and thentransfered the material into Latin alphabet. In the text, out of proverbs, there are also idioms, prayers, maledictions, repartees, varied expressions, quatrains and couplets, which take place heterogenously.Since we limited the subject of our study as ? Metonomy at Qasqai Proverbs?, we excluded idioms, prayers, expressions, repartees from our investigation. We gave way to Turkey Turkish equivalents of 2564 proverbs which we have classified, and we just translated to Turkey Turkish which had not a direct equivalent in Turkey TurkishWe made noun transfers at Qashqai Proverbs, on the 2564 proverbs which we have determined. While determining noun transfer kinds, we were commited to classification of M.A. Yekta SARAÇ, which he has mentioned at his work Classical Literature Information-Belâgat.Besides, in order to maket the proverbs more intelligible, we added a selected dictionary to the end of the study.One of the aims of this study is that, eradicating the lack of Qashqai proverbs in the pool of proverbs of Turkish World. It is aimed to give some help to ?Turkish World Proverbs Dictinary? which will be prepared in the future.
